|
Stockholders' Equity - Summary of Warrant Activity (Detail) (USD $)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2012
|Common shares Issuable upon Exercise
|Outstanding at December 31, 2013 (in shares)
|6,185,492
|Issued (in shares)
|674,190
|Exercised (in shares)
|0
|Cancelled (in shares)
|0
|Outstanding as of December 31, 2014 (in shares)
|6,859,682
|Exercisable at December 31, 2014 (in shares)
|6,859,682
|Weighted Average Exercise Price
|Outstanding at December 31, 2013 (USD per Share)
|$ 4.01
|Issued (USD per Share)
|$ 2.19
|Exercised (USD per Share)
|$ 0.00
|Cancelled (USD per Share)
|$ 0.00
|Outstanding at December 31, 2014 (USD per Share)
|$ 3.83
|Exercisable at December 31, 2014 (USD per Share)
|$ 3.83
|Weighted Average Contractual Life
|Outstanding at December 31, 2013 (in years)
|3 years 7 months 6 days
|Outstanding at December 31, 2014 (in years)
|2 years 8 months 6 days
|Exercisable at December 31, 2014 (in years)
|2 years 8 months 6 days
|X
|
- Definition
Share Based Compensation Arrangement by Share Based Payment Award Equity Instruments Other Than Options Exercisable Weighted Average Remaining Contractual Term
No definition available.
|X
|
- Definition
Share based Compensation Arrangement by Share based Payment Award, Equity Instruments Other than Options, Outstanding, Weighted Average Remaining Contractual Term 1
No definition available.
|X
|
- Definition
Share-based Compensation Arrangement by Share-based Payment Award, Equity Instruments Other than Options, Outstanding, Weighted Average Remaining Contractual Terms 1
No definition available.
|X
|
- Details
|X
|
- Details
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Option Equity Instruments Exercisable Number
No definition available.
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Option Equity Instruments Exercisable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Option Equity Instruments Exercises In Period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Option Equity Instruments Grants In Period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Option Equity Instruments Outstanding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Share Based Compensation Arrangement By Share Based Payment Award Non Options Equity Instruments Forfeited Weighted Average Exercise Price
No definition available.
|X
|
- Definition
Number of non-option equity instruments exercised by participants.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Number of shares under non-option equity instrument agreements that were cancelled as a result of occurrence of a terminating event.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Net number of non-option equity instruments granted to participants.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Number of equity instruments other than options outstanding, including both vested and non-vested instruments.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details